Warbler Woods Bird Sanctuary Visiting Warbler Woods Bird Sanctuary is a premier inland migrant stop for migratory birds and home to many resident birds. They have had 289 species of birds and 40 species of warblers. Please join us to see some of the beautiful songbirds that go through our area. People travel from across the United States to see the wonders of Migration each year here. In 2011, they won the Texas Land Steward Award for the Blackland Prairie from TPWL. We are also a Gulf Coast Bird Observatory inland site partner and are a Hotspot on Ebird. This Jewel is located between Cibolo and Schertz on heavily wooded, private property. There are 124 acres of trails, including heavily wooded areas. WarblerWoods.org. Reservations needed to visit Introduce yourself and request a date and approximate time to visit.
